Ovulation Induction is a fertility treatment used to stimulate the ovaries to produce and release eggs in women who have irregular or absent ovulation. It is often the first step in fertility treatment and can be done using oral medications or injectable hormones. This method helps in increasing the chances of natural conception or may be used in conjunction with procedures like Intrauterine Insemination (IUI).

Ovulation Induction is particularly beneficial for women who suffer from:

  • Polycystic Ovary Syndrome (PCOS)
  • Irregular menstrual cycles
  • Anovulation (absence of ovulation)
  • Hormonal imbalances
  • Unexplained infertility

The process usually involves the following steps:

Before starting ovulation induction, the woman undergoes tests to assess hormone levels, ovarian reserve, and overall reproductive health. This may include:

  • AMH (Anti-Müllerian Hormone) test
  • FSH and LH levels
  • Thyroid profile
  • Pelvic ultrasound

Depending on individual needs, medications such as Clomiphene Citrate (Clomid) or Letrozole are prescribed. These oral drugs help stimulate the release of hormones necessary for ovulation. In some cases, injectable gonadotropins may be used.

Regular ultrasounds and blood tests are conducted to monitor the growth of ovarian follicles. This helps in timing intercourse or scheduling IUI at the optimal time for fertilization.

Once the follicles reach an appropriate size, a hormone injection (commonly hCG) is given to induce the final maturation and release of the egg.

Ovulation usually occurs 24-36 hours after the trigger shot. Couples are advised to have intercourse or undergo IUI during this fertile window.

Ovulation induction is one of the most successful and least invasive fertility treatments. Success rates vary, but studies show that up to 80% of women ovulate after induction therapy, and about 20-25% conceive per cycle when combined with IUI.

The success depends on:

  • Age of the woman
  • Underlying cause of infertility
  • Type of medication used
  • Response of ovaries to stimulation

Yes, ovulation induction is generally safe when done under the supervision of fertility experts. However, like any medical procedure, it can carry some risks, such as:

  • Multiple pregnancies (twins or more)
  • Ovarian hyperstimulation syndrome (OHSS) in rare cases
  • Mild side effects like mood swings, bloating, or headaches
